Lady Panthers deliver smackdown to Lady Wildcats in season opener

by John Earp

The first game of the season opener for the Lady Panthers against the Lovington Lady Wildcats started out a bit iffy Tuesday evening for the Lady Panthers, with Lovington pulling ahead 6-2 early on. The Lady Panthers rallied back a bit, closing the gap on the scoreboard to just one point, with Lovington leading 7-6. The Lady Panthers then pulled ahead 9-8 before the Lady Wildcats regained the lead, 11-10. The Lady Wildcats then proceeded to extend their lead 16-11 over the next several minutes, with several very hard-fought points. The Lady Panthers then started really gaining momentum, and in due course were able to pulled ahead 20-19, eventually winning 25-23. In the second game, the Lady Panthers pulled ahead 11-8, and then maintained their momentum for the next several minutes, pulling further ahead, 19-12. The Lady Panthers continued to lead, though the Wildcats fought back hard. The Lady Panthers came out on top 25-18 in the second game.

The Lady Wildcats came out fighting in the third game, pulling ahead of Jal 18-13. The Lady Panthers rallied back though, closing the gap to just two points. The Wildcats won the third game. The fourth game of the match exhibited the same close competition as the previous games had shown, with the Panthers leading 14-12 about halfway through. The Panthers won the fourth game 25-18, thus winning their opening match of the season on a high note. The Lady Panthers showed a lot of discipline, teamwork, heart and skill in their game Tuesday, and certainly demonstrated that they have what it takes to do well this year.
